嵌入式系统工程师职业机会高薪嵌入式软件开发岗位
嵌入式系统工程师职业机会:高薪嵌入式软件开发岗位
为什么嵌入式工作好找吗?
在现代科技的快速发展下,嵌入式系统已经渗透到了我们生活的方方面面,从智能手机到汽车、从医疗设备到家用电器,几乎无处不在。随着技术的进步和市场需求的增长,对于具有专业知识和技能的人才的需求也日益增加。这使得许多人对嵌入式工作充满了兴趣,但是否真的能找到这样的机会,这里我们就来探讨一下。
什么是嵌入式系统?
首先,我们要明确一点:什么是嵌入式系统?简单来说,嵌入式系统就是指那些用于特定应用领域中的一种计算机控制系统,它们通常被集成到硬件设备中,并且与外部环境进行交互。这些设备可以是非常简单,如微型控制器,也可以非常复杂,如超级计算机。因此,无论是在电子产品还是工业自动化领域,都需要大量专业的人才去设计、开发和维护这些复杂而精密的硬件和软件组合体。
嵒(embedded)是什么意思?
"Embedded"这个词源自英语,是指“内置”的含义。在计算机科学中,“embedded”意味着将一个程序或操作系统直接安装在一个非通用计算平台上,比如说一台智能手表上的操作系统,就是一个典型例子。在这个过程中,一些基本功能被剔除,只保留必要的功能,使其更加专注于执行特定的任务,而不是像PC那样提供全面的用户界面。
如何成为一名优秀的嵌入软件工程师?
为了成为一名优秀的嵌入软(SW)工程师,你需要具备扎实的地理信息学(GIS)、物理学基础,以及对编程语言如C++、Java等有深刻理解。此外,了解并掌握一些相关工具和框架,如Linux内核、物联网(IoT)、云服务(Cloud)等也是必不可少的一部分。而且,由于项目多样性较大,要根据实际情况灵活调整自己的学习计划,以适应不同行业不同的需求。
嵋(software)工程师如何实现梦想?
对于想要追求梦想的人来说,可以考虑从事一些开源项目或者参与一些大学的小规模研究项目,这样不仅能够锻炼你的技能,还能帮助你建立起丰富的人脉网络。当你积累了一定的经验后,你就有能力申请更好的工作了。不断提升自己,不断寻找新的挑战,是成为顶尖技术人才必须具备的心态。
个人经历分享
我自己曾经是一名学生时期通过参加学校组织的一个小型创新竞赛获得奖励,那个时候我第一次接触到了ARM Cortex-M4处理器以及相关硬件设计与编程这门课程。我发现自己对这种东西感兴趣,并开始不断地学习各种编程语言,同时也逐渐建立起自己的实验室环境。我发现当你真正投身其中的时候,每一次成功解决问题都是一次宝贵的心血结晶。现在,我正以此为基础,在我的公司担任一个重要角色,为客户提供高质量服务,同时也在寻求更多新的挑战。
结语
总之,如果你对电子产品、自动化或者任何涉及到代码运行直接影响硬件行为的情况感兴趣,那么作为一种专业领域,即便是在全球范围内,也同样存在大量可供选择的地方。虽然每个岗位可能会有其独特性,但共有的都是关于创造力与技术结合的问题解答。如果你愿意投身这一行,你很快就会发现答案——那就是“当然”。